And these things happened as examples for us, to stop us from ·wanting [desiring; craving] evil things as those people did. Do not worship idols, as some of them did. Just as it is written in the Scriptures: “The people sat down to eat and drink, and then they got up and ·sinned sexually [L played; C a euphemism for immoral revelry; Ex. 32:6].” We must not take part in sexual sins, as some of them did. In one day twenty-three thousand of them ·died because of their sins [L fell; Num 25:1–9]. We must not test Christ as some of them did; they were ·killed [destroyed] by snakes. 10 Do not ·complain [grumble] as some of them did; they were killed by the ·angel that destroys [L destroyer; Num. 16:41–50; Ex. 12:23].

Now these things occurred as examples(A) to keep us from setting our hearts on evil things as they did. Do not be idolaters,(B) as some of them were; as it is written: “The people sat down to eat and drink and got up to indulge in revelry.”[a](C) We should not commit sexual immorality, as some of them did—and in one day twenty-three thousand of them died.(D) We should not test Christ,[b](E) as some of them did—and were killed by snakes.(F) 10 And do not grumble, as some of them did(G)—and were killed(H) by the destroying angel.(I)
